It deletes branches inactive 90+ days on repos tagged "managed." Exclusions live in the trimbot.yml allowlist; release branches must be listed there before every freeze. Prunewell handles false-deletion restores within one business day under the support tier we pay for. Do not attempt restores locally; their audit log is authoritative. Contract renewal decision is due before the next release cycle. Direct all support and renewal requests here.

escalation mailbox, bafog-fafog: ulador@paliqlabs.internal

## Veltrix Environments — Cold Storage Archiving

Buckets idle for 180 days move to the archive tier via the nightly Frostbin job. Don't archive anything tagged `legal-hold`. Restores take up to 12 hours; file a ticket with the Plinth team first. Staging mirrors prod behavior but with a 7-day threshold. The archiver reads the following settings:

deployment values, kajep-kageg:
[praix]
host = praix.paliqcorp.corp
user = praix_svc
database = praix_prod

# SQL Linting — Who to Contact

Lint failures on SQL files in the Quartzline repo are enforced by the Sqlsmith ruleset. Support team: do not grant exceptions or edit rule configs. Formatting complaints go to the authoring team; rule-change requests need a ticket tagged `sqlsmith-rules`. For broken lint runs or false positives, contact the tooling maintainers at the address below.

escalation mailbox, yajog-kahag: holmir_olimir@lumicsys.corp